The former president’s comments came after Texas lawmakers approved plans to redefine the state’s congressional district and passed a new map on Wednesday Donald TrumpBefore the 2026 midterm elections, we hope to tilt the map of the US house.
Voting is 88 Agree, 52 Oppose.
The map could offer Republicans five new home seats in 2026 and took more than two weeks after Democratic lawmakers strike amid what they call a “power grab.” Several lawmakers traveled to states run by Democrats, and the protests eventually laid the foundation for the redistribution battle now taking place nationwide.
In the case of Texas, Democratic governors including Newsom Ways of thinking To strengthen partisan positions by redrawing the U.S. House area, five years from the census number, such procedures have often led to.
In California – In 2010, voters were given the power to map the Congressional map to the Independent Commission with the aim of reducing the process partisanship – Democrats already A suggestion was made This could allow the state’s main political parties to add five U.S. Houses to win the fight Control Congress next year. if Approved by voters In November, the Blueprint could remove Republican House members in almost the most populous states of the United States, with Democrats planning to win 48 of their 52 U.S. House seats, up from 43.

A Republican lawmaker clashed with Democrats and a hearing on the measure turned into a shouting game Tuesday, with the committee voting along the party to advance a new Congressional map. California Democrats can move forward without any Republican vote, and lawmakers are expected to approve the proposed Congressional map and announce Special elections on November 4 By Thursday, get the required voter approval.
Newsom and Democratic leaders say they will require voters to approve their new maps only in the next few elections and return map mapping power to the commission after the 2030 census, and only the Republican state moves forward with a new map. Obama praised that temporary timetable.
“We’re going to do this for the time being because we’re always focusing on where we want to be in the long term,” Obama said. “I think this approach is a clever, measure approach that aims to solve a very specific problem at a very special moment.”
